Instructions For Authors

Authors are invited to submit original, unpublished research papers addressing the themes of FET’26. Submissions must not have been published or concurrently submitted elsewhere. Each paper should identify the corresponding author, include an abstract (150–250 words) written in one paragraph, and list up to six keywords.

Submission Guidelines

  • Submission System: All papers must be submitted via the EDAS FET’26 submission portal https://edas.info/N34437
  • Paper Length: Minimum 4 pages – Maximum 6 pages (including figures, tables, and references). Papers exceeding 8 pages will not be accepted.
  • Format: Use the official IEEE Conference Templates (for Word and LaTeX). Download templates from the IEEE Conference Publishing website.
  • Review Process: Each paper will be double-blind reviewed by at least three qualified reviewers.
  • Evaluation Criteria: Technical significance, quality, clarity of presentation, relevance, and originality.
Publication and Indexing

Accepted papers within the scope of IEEE will be submitted for inclusion into IEEE Xplore . Selected papers presented at the conference will be invited to submit extended versions of their manuscripts for consideration in UoB journals.

Ethical and Quality Requirements
  • All submissions will undergo a similarity check.
  • Plagiarism, self-plagiarism, and double submission are strictly prohibited.
  • Excessive self-citations are not allowed.
  • Papers violating ethical standards or exceeding similarity limits will be rejected without review.
  • Non-compliance with FET’26 policies may lead to removal from IEEE Xplore®.
Registration and Presentation Policy

To ensure inclusion in the proceedings and IEEE Xplore®:

    1. Author Registration: At least one author of each accepted paper must register at the full author rate (IEEE member or non-member).
    2. Presentation Requirement: Each accepted paper must be presented by an author or co-author at the conference.

Failure to present will result in removal from the IEEE Xplore® indexing.
